4. Code of Conduct Content:
- Organize the content into sections or categories, each addressing specific aspects of the code.
- Use clear and concise language to outline the rules and guidelines for using the website.
- Include subheadings and bullet points to make the content easily scannable.
- Provide examples or scenarios when necessary to illustrate expected behavior.
- Highlight consequences for violating the code, such as account suspension or removal of listings.
5. Visuals:
- Incorporate relevant images or icons to break up the text and make the content more engaging.
- Use icons or symbols to represent different rules or guidelines for quick reference.
6. Reporting Mechanisms:
- Include information on how users can report violations of the Code of Conduct, such as a “Report” button on listings or contact details for your support team.
- Explain the process for reporting and the confidentiality of reports.
7.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s):
- Add a section with commonly asked questions related to the Code of Conduct.
- Provide concise answers to help users understand the rules better.
